✨ The Power Behind the Leaves: A Closer Look

Each leaf in this infusion contributes a unique profile of beneficial compounds. Guava leaves are rich in flavonoids like quercetin, known for their anti-inflammatory and antimicrobial qualities, and have been traditionally used to aid digestive comfort. Soursop (Guanábana) leaves are a source of acetogenins and alkaloids, often studied for their cellular antioxidant potential, and are popularly used in herbal practices for relaxation support. Mango leaves contain mangiferin, a powerful polyphenol with noted antioxidant and metabolic properties. When combined with turmeric—a golden root revered for its active compound curcumin, a potent anti-inflammatory agent—this blend creates a synergistic tea aimed at promoting overall vitality from within.

✅ What You'll Need: Quality Ingredients

Gathering fresh, clean ingredients is the first step to an effective infusion. Ensure leaves are sourced from organic, pesticide-free trees if possible.

  • 4-5 fresh Guava leaves, thoroughly washed and cut into small pieces.
  • 4-5 fresh Soursop (Guanábana) leaves, washed and chopped.
  • 4-5 fresh Mango leaves, cleaned and sliced.
  • ½ liter (about 2 cups) of filtered water.
  • ½ teaspoon of high-quality Turmeric powder (or a small piece of fresh turmeric root, grated).

Tip: If fresh leaves are unavailable, high-quality dried leaves can be used; reduce the quantity by about one-third as their flavor is more concentrated. 🌱

📝 Step-by-Step Preparation Guide

Follow these simple steps to unlock the full benefits of your herbal infusion.

  1. Prepare the Leaves: Wash all leaves meticulously under cool running water to remove any dust or impurities. Pat them dry and cut or tear them into small pieces to maximize surface area and release their compounds.
  2. Combine & Simmer: Place the prepared leaves in a small saucepan or pot. Add the half liter of water and the turmeric powder. Stir gently.
  3. Infuse with Heat: Bring the mixture to a gentle boil over medium heat. Once boiling, reduce the heat to low, cover, and let it simmer for 15-20 minutes. This slow simmer helps extract the bioactive constituents effectively.
  4. Strain & Serve: After simmering, turn off the heat. Using a fine-mesh strainer or cheesecloth, strain the liquid into a cup or teapot, pressing the leaves gently to extract all the beneficial liquid. Your infusion is ready to enjoy.

The resulting tea will have a deep amber or greenish hue and an earthy, herbaceous flavor. You may add a thin slice of lemon or a dab of raw honey to taste, as these can also enhance nutrient absorption. 🫖

⚠️ Crucial Safety Information & Professional Guidance

This natural infusion is not a substitute for professional medical advice, diagnosis, or treatment. This point cannot be overstated.

  • It is NOT a medication for serious conditions such as cancer, diabetes, hypertension, or chronic circulatory disorders. Always follow your doctor's prescribed treatment plan.
  • Consult your physician or a qualified herbalist before starting any new herbal regimen, especially if you have pre-existing health conditions, are pregnant, or are breastfeeding.
  • Be aware of potential interactions. Herbal compounds can interact with prescription medications (e.g., blood thinners, diabetes drugs, blood pressure medication). A healthcare provider can help you navigate this safely.
  • Start slowly. When trying any new herb, begin with a smaller amount to monitor for any personal allergic reactions or sensitivities.

Your safety is paramount. A professional can provide personalized advice that considers your unique health profile. 👩‍⚕️
